Q: Is 94,185,876 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 94,185,876 is not a prime number.

Why is 94,185,876 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 94185876 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 12 53 106 159 212 318 636 148,091 296,182 444,273 592,364 888,546 1,777,092 7,848,823 15,697,646 23,546,469 31,395,292 47,092,938 and 94,185,876, with no remainder.

Since 94,185,876 cannot be divided by just 1 and 94,185,876, it is not a prime number.
